Abstract
The utility model discloses a kind of CCD translation interfaces camera lens, including body tube and can opposite body tube rotation cam, it is characterised in that:Microscope base is equipped with the body tube; lens set is equipped with the microscope base; the lens set is connected through guide pin component with cam; the cam side is equipped with the limited block of adjustable position; the limited block is spirally connected with body tube through nut, and the body tube front end is equipped with object lens protective cover, and rear end is equipped with CCD protecting cover for joint; imaging sensor is equipped with before the CCD protecting cover for joint, the primary mirror tube inner surface is additionally provided with insulating layer.The utility model has is focused using cam driven lead ring, guide pin movement in systems, this simple in structure, is not in catching phenomenon;Be equipped with insulating layer in primary mirror tube inner surface, can more preferably prevent the heat exchange inside and outside lens barrel, ensure image clearly not defocus the advantages that.

Embodiment
The following is a combination of the drawings in the embodiments of the present utility model, and the technical scheme in the embodiment of the utility model is carried out
Clearly and completely describe.
A kind of CCD translation interfaces camera lens as shown in Figure 1, including body tube 1 and can the opposite rotation of body tube 1 cam 2,
Microscope base 3 is equipped with the body tube 1, is equipped with lens set 4 in the microscope base 3, the lens set 4 is through guide pin component 5 and 2 phase of cam
Even, 2 side of cam is equipped with the limited block 6 of adjustable position, and the limited block 6 is spirally connected with body tube 1 through nut 15, described
1 front end of body tube is equipped with object lens protective cover 7, and rear end is equipped with CCD protecting cover for joint 8, figure is equipped with before the CCD protecting cover for joint 8
As sensor 9,1 inner surface of body tube is additionally provided with insulating layer 10.
In the present embodiment, it is saturating to be equipped with negative selenodont lens, biconcave lens and negative selenodont successively for the lens set 4
Mirror, the airspace between the negative selenodont lens and biconcave lens is 3.86mm, and biconcave lens and negative selenodont are saturating
Airspace between mirror is 1.25mm.
In this embodiment, the 2 rear end circumference of cam is equipped with the cam wheel 14 of annular, is rotated for driving cam 2.
In this embodiment, the guide pin component 5 includes lead ring 11 and guide pin 12, and the lead ring 11 is located on guide pin 12.
In the present embodiment, the cam wheel 14 is rotated for driving cam 2, then passes through lead ring 11, guide pin 12
Lens set 4 is passed motion to, by the convert rotational motion of cam 2 moving in parallel for 4 optical axis direction of lens set.In body tube
Two wide linear guide grooves 13 are provided with 1, limit the movement locus of lead ring, therefore during cam positive and negative rotation, can band index glass
Piece group 4 does linear reciprocating motion.
In the present embodiment, the limited block 6 being spirally connected with body tube 1 through nut 15, by adjusting locknut 15, makes cam
2 go slick so that focusing is more accurate.
In the present embodiment, the insulating layer 10 is vacuum heat-insulating layer, for improving the heat-insulating property of camera lens, avoids camera lens
Disturbed be subject to ambient temperature, improve the image quality of camera lens.So far, the present utility model purpose is accomplished.
